Morpheus8 vs. Sofwave: A Dermatologist’s Perspective on Two Popular Skin Treatments

Robin Lewallen, MD, FAAD As a dermatologist, I’m often asked about the latest technologies for skin rejuvenation, and two treatments that frequently come up are Morpheus8 and Sofwave. Both are cutting-edge devices that can help tighten skin, improve texture, and reduce the signs of aging, but they work in fundamentally different ways. Morpheus8: Deep Skin Remodeling with RF Microneedling Morpheus8 is a fractional skin treatment that combines microneedling with radiofrequency (RF) energy to target deeper layers of the skin. This dual-action approach stimulates collagen production and promotes skin remodeling from the inside out.
  • How It Works:
    • Tiny needles penetrate the skin, delivering radiofrequency energy deep into the dermis.
    • This stimulates collagen and elastin production, tightening the skin and improving its texture.
    • The depth of penetration can be customized depending on the treatment area, making it effective for both superficial and deeper concerns.
  • Benefits:
    • Skin Tightening: Morpheus8 is excellent for addressing laxity in areas like the neck, jowls, and lower face.
    • Scar Reduction: The combination of microneedling and RF can significantly improve the appearance of acne scars or surgical scars.
    • Minimal Downtime: While some redness and swelling are expected, recovery is typically quick compared to surgical procedures.
    • Customizable: The device can treat different depths, making it versatile for a variety of skin types and concerns.
  • Ideal Candidates:
    • Morpheus8 is great for individuals seeking improvement in skin laxity, texture, or scarring. It’s especially effective for those experiencing early to moderate signs of aging or wanting to address acne scars.
Sofwave: Ultrasound for Skin Lifting and Collagen Stimulation Sofwave is a non-invasive ultrasound technology designed to lift and tighten the skin by stimulating collagen in the mid-dermal layers. Unlike Morpheus8, Sofwave does not penetrate the skin but instead works at a specific depth to promote skin rejuvenation.
  • How It Works:
    • The device delivers ultrasound energy to the mid-dermis, heating the tissue at an optimal depth to trigger collagen production.
    • The outer layer of the skin remains untouched, resulting in minimal discomfort and no downtime.
  • Benefits:
    • Skin Lifting: Sofwave is FDA-cleared to lift the eyebrows, neck, and submental (under the chin) areas, providing a subtle, natural-looking lift.
    • Fine Lines & Wrinkles: It effectively softens wrinkles, particularly around the eyes and on the forehead.
    • No Downtime: Patients can resume their regular activities immediately after treatment.
    • Comfortable: The treatment is well-tolerated, often performed with topical numbing or cooling for added comfort.
  • Ideal Candidates:
    • Sofwave is perfect for individuals looking for mild to moderate skin tightening and wrinkle reduction without downtime. It’s a great option for those who want to prevent early signs of aging or achieve subtle improvements.
Which Treatment is Right for You? While both Morpheus8 and Sofwave stimulate collagen and improve skin quality, they cater to different needs:
Feature Morpheus 8 Sofwave
Technology RF Microneedling Ultrasound
Treatment Depth Epidermis, Dermis, and/or Subdermal Fat  (customizable 0.5-7mm) Mid-Dermis (1.5 mm)
Best For Laxity, Scarring, Deep Wrinkles Mild lifting, fine lines
Downtime Minimal  None
Pain Level Moderate  Mild
